Abstract :
Keyframe is widely used in applications such as non-linear browsing, video content analysis and so on. How to obtain keyframes from video rapidly becomes very important. In this paper, a scheme to extract keyframes from compressed video stream is proposed. It firstly computes the similarity set of adjacent I frames´ DC images, secondly applies clustering algorithm to the similarity set, and finally selects keyframes with the clustering results. The experiment results show that our method is able to extract proper keyframes from test video files fast and easily.
